2-[5-chloro-2-[(2-methylpropan-2-yl)oxycarbonylamino]-1,3-thiazol-4-yl]-2-cyclopentyloxyiminoacetic acid (PubChem CID 91541160) has the molecular formula C15H20ClN3O5S and a molecular weight of 389.86 g/mol. Its IUPAC name is 2-[5-chloro-2-[(2-methylpropan-2-yl)oxycarbonylamino]-1,3-thiazol-4-yl]-2-cyclopentyloxyiminoacetic acid.
